DFW Ranks #2 in the Nation for New Home Construction

When it comes to growth, Dallas–Fort Worth continues to prove it’s in a league of its own. According to recent data, our metroplex ranked #2 nationally for new home builder permits, a strong indicator that developers, buyers, and investors all see long-term opportunity here.So why is this happening? A few key drivers are fueling the surge:

- Population Growth: D/FW gains over 300 new residents daily. More people means more housing demand.
- Job Market Strength: With new corporate headquarters, industrial facilities, and major infrastructure projects (think DFW Airport’s expansion and Siemens’ new Fort Worth plant), the job base is expanding — and workers need homes.
- Relative Affordability: Compared to other top metro areas like Austin, Denver, or Los Angeles, D/FW still offers more house for the money. Builders know that value attracts both locals and transplants.
- Land Availability: While urban cores are getting denser, suburban cities like Celina, Prosper, Mansfield, and Forney still offer space for large master-planned communities.
